Published by Nasionale Pers, 1926


Hardcover with pictorial boards. Book is in good condition for its age - front cover has some wrinkling to the bottom, pages slightly age toned. Previous owner inscription present


"Verrigtinge met die Plegtige Teraardebestelling van die Stoflike Oorskot van Emily Hobhouse aan die voet van die Nasionale Vroue Monument [in Bloemfontein] op 27 Oktober 1926". 


Double sided b&w frontis of Emily Hobhouse taken shortly after the Boer War and one shortly before her death. Also a photograph of Miss Hobhouse sorting out donations for the womens camp; and a photograph of Miss Hobhouse sitting outside her house in St Ives, Cornwall, England. 52 pages.
